
Indonesia’s palm oil exports increase by 244 million U.S. dollars in July

Illustration. Indonesia’s exports of palm oil and its derivative products in July 2020 increased by 15 percent or 244 million U.S. dollars to 1.86 billion U.S. dollars compared to those in the previous month. (tk tan from Pixabay)
